[jira] [Created] (FLINK-25952) Savepoint on S3 are not relocatable even if entropy injection is not enabled

We have a limitation that if we create savepoints with an injected entropy, they are not relocatable (https://nightlies.apache.org/flink/flink-docs-master/docs/ops/state/savepoints/#triggering-savepoints).

However the check if we use the entropy is flawed. In {{FsCheckpointStreamFactory}} we check only if the used filesystem extends from {{EntropyInjectingFileSystem}}. {{FlinkS3FileSystem}} does, but it still may have the entropy disabled. {{FlinkS3FileSystem#getEntropyInjectionKey}} may still return {{null}}. We should check for that in {{org.apache.flink.core.fs.EntropyInjector#isEntropyInjecting}}
